从不同的html文件创建唯一文件名时遇到问题

时间:2018-09-22 21:58:28

标签: r text

我有不同的html文本文件,它们的名称是text1 text2 text3 ... texts400。这些是我使用以下命令(一个示例)读取R的html文件:

text56 <- read_html("https://tr.wikisource.org/wiki/Recep_Tayyip_Erdo%C4%9Fan%27%C4%B1n_Ocak_2011%27deki_ulusa_sesleni%C5%9F_konu%C5%9Fmas%C4%B1 ")

现在,我正在尝试创建一个唯一的html文本文件,并且正在使用以下命令:

out.file <- "" 
file.names <- text[i] 
for(i in 1:length(file.names)) {
  file <- read.table(file.names[i],header=TRUE, sep=";", stringsAsFactors=FALSE)
  out.file <- rbind(out.file, file)
}
write.table(out.file, file = "myfilename.txt",sep=";", 
         row.names = FALSE, qmethod = "double",fileEncoding="windows-1252")

但是第二行有一个问题是      file.names <- text[i]
由于我正在尝试定义文件名,但是它没有使用该命令定义所有文件。任何想法如何克服这个问题,或者如何用不同的html文本文件创建一个唯一的html文本文件?

0 个答案:

没有答案